### **Marine Adhesive Market Adhesive Type Insights**

The Marine Adhesive Market is segmented based on Adhesive Type into Epoxy Adhesives, Polyurethane Adhesives, Acrylic Adhesives, and Silicone Adhesives. Epoxy Adhesives held the largest market share in 2023, accounting for over 35% of the Marine Adhesive Market revenue. This is due to their exceptional bonding strength, durability, and resistance to harsh marine environments. Epoxy adhesives are widely used in shipbuilding, boat repair, and offshore construction applications. Polyurethane Adhesives are another important segment, expected to witness significant growth over the forecast period.These adhesives offer excellent flexibility, resistance to moisture and chemicals, and fast curing times.

Polyurethane adhesives are commonly used in marine insulation, flooring, and sealing applications. Acrylic Adhesives are gaining popularity in the marine industry due to their ease of application, versatility, and cost-effectiveness. These adhesives provide strong bonds on a variety of surfaces, including metals, plastics, and composites. Acrylic adhesives are often used in marine electronics, signage, and decorative applications. Silicone Adhesives are known for their excellent sealing properties, resistance to extreme temperatures, and UV stability.These adhesives are widely used in marine glazing, weatherstripping, and other sealing applications.

Silicone adhesives are also gaining traction in marine solar panel installations due to their weather resistance and durability. ### **Marine Adhesive Market Substrate Insights**

The Marine Adhesive Market is segmented by substrate into metal, plastic, wood, and composite. Metal is the largest segment, accounting for over 40% of the market in 2023. Plastic is the second largest segment, followed by wood and composite. The metal seg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.5% from 2023 to 2032, reaching a value of USD 6.2 billion by 2032. The plastic seg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.3% from 2023 to 2032, reaching a value of USD 4.5 billion by 2032.

The wood seg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.2% from 2023 to 2032, reaching a value of USD 2.8 billion by 2032.The composite seg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.1% from 2023 to 2032, reaching a value of USD 1.7 billion by 2032. ### By Type: Epoxy Adhesives (Largest) vs. Polyurethane Adhesives (Fastest-Growing)

The marine adhesive market is characterized by a diverse range of adhesives, with epoxy adhesives leading in market share due to their robust bonding capabilities and chemical resistance. This segment dominates because of its extensive applications in boat building and repair, providing necessary strength and durability in harsh marine environments. Polyurethane adhesives follow closely as a significant player due to their versatility and superior flexibility, becoming increasingly popular for varied applications in boat construction and maintenance.

Emerging trends highlight a surge in the demand for polyurethane adhesives, attributed to their eco-friendly properties and the increasing need for [lightweight materials](https://www.marketresearchfuture.com/reports/lightweight-materials-market-8528) in marine applications. Additionally, technological advancements have led to the development of innovative formulations that enhance performance and usability. As environmental regulations tighten, the shift towards biodegradable and low-VOC adhesives is propelling the growth of the polyurethane segment, making it the fastest-growing type within the marine adhesive market.

Epoxy Adhesives (Dominant) vs. Silicone Adhesives (Emerging)

Epoxy adhesives are known for their exceptional strength and adherence, making them the dominant type in the marine adhesive market. Their chemical resistance and ability to bond various substrates, including metals and composites, render them ideal for structural applications in boat manufacturing. On the other hand, silicone adhesives are emerging in the market due to their excellent flexibility and thermal stability, making them suitable for sealing and joint applications. While they do not match the sheer strength of epoxy, silicone adhesives are gaining traction for their ease of use and resilience against harsh marine conditions, catering to specific applications where movement and expansion are factors.

- **Q2 2024: Henkel opens new adhesive manufacturing facility in India to meet growing demand in marine and industrial sectors** Henkel inaugurated a new adhesives plant in Kurkumbh, India, in April 2024, expanding its production capacity for high-performance adhesives, including those used in marine applications, to serve the South Asian market.
- **Q1 2024: 3M launches next-generation marine adhesive sealant for commercial shipbuilding** 3M introduced a new marine adhesive sealant designed for enhanced durability and environmental resistance, targeting commercial shipbuilders and repair yards.
- **Q2 2024: Sika expands marine adhesives portfolio with new eco-friendly polyurethane product** Sika announced the launch of a new environmentally friendly polyurethane-based marine adhesive, formulated to meet stricter environmental regulations and improve performance in shipbuilding.
- **Q2 2024: Bostik opens new R&D center focused on marine and transportation adhesives** Bostik, an Arkema company, opened a dedicated research and development center in France to accelerate innovation in marine adhesives and sealants.
- **Q1 2024: Huntsman launches advanced epoxy adhesive for marine composite bonding** Huntsman introduced a new epoxy adhesive specifically engineered for bonding composite materials in marine vessel construction, offering improved strength and water resistance.
- **Q2 2024: Ashland debuts bio-based marine adhesive at international boat show** Ashland unveiled a new bio-based marine adhesive at the 2024 International Boat Show, highlighting its commitment to sustainable solutions for the marine industry.
- **Q2 2024: Avery Dennison acquires specialty marine adhesive business from private firm** Avery Dennison completed the acquisition of a specialty marine adhesive manufacturer, expanding its product offerings for the global marine sector.
- **Q1 2024: Dow partners with leading shipbuilder to supply next-gen marine adhesives** Dow announced a strategic partnership with a major European shipbuilder to supply advanced marine adhesives for use in new vessel construction.
- **Q2 2024: Sika appoints new Head of Marine Adhesives Division** Sika named a new executive to lead its Marine Adhesives Division, aiming to strengthen its position in the global marine adhesives market.
- **Q1 2024: Henkel signs supply agreement with major yacht manufacturer for marine adhesives** Henkel secured a multi-year supply agreement to provide marine adhesives to a leading European yacht manufacturer, supporting the production of luxury vessels.
